Taiwan's Latest Bread Trend is Bread That Looks Like Watermelon
Jul 10, 2015 21:32
Taiwan has yet another groundbreaking trend that's catching on like wild fire. Would you like to eat bread that looks like watermelon? Because this is getting really popular now!
Invented by a baker who wanted to encourage kids to eat more during the heat of summer.
It is made with green tea powder and strawberries to give it the appearance of a watermelon.
Also, it's quite delicious.
And it's gotten so trendy that the baker is selling 100 loaves a day.
